An Ceann Mòr on the shores of Loch Lomond at Inveruglas Visitor Centre, is an art installation for the Scottish Scenic Routes project. Can’t say I think much of the art work, but it’s a useful platform for getting great views of Loch Lomond and the surrounding glens. There’s even a pair of defunct binoculars to puzzle visitors, but maybe that’s part of the art too esoteric for me to understand.

Go for the views, the art work wasn't my thing.

Beautiful architecture, in the form of a wooden Viewing Pyramid that then allows wonderful views across Loch Lomond.

Solid, steady stepped access via the purpose built path to the left from the car park. Therefore not suitable for prams/wheelchairs as such, but is only a gentle route so easily reachable for those without any mobility issues, even if elderly or not avid walkers.

But be fair if you enjoy it, and drop a coin or two in the charity donation support box just behind it.
